Wicked Problems

Some problems are so complex that you have to be highly intelligent and well informed just to be undecided about them.

▪ Laurence Peter

Page 11: The Interdisciplinary World General Education as a Basis for Career and Service Herb Childress Boston Architectural College.

Wicked ProblemsDEFINITIONAL CHARACTERISTICS:

• Can’t be fully defined, or even described

• Can be stated as symptoms of other problems

• Diagnosis depends on the definition

• Changes while we wait

Page 12: The Interdisciplinary World General Education as a Basis for Career and Service Herb Childress Boston Architectural College.

Wicked ProblemsOPERATIONAL CHARACTERISTICS:

• No fixed body of operations or actions

• Each iteration is unique, limits knowledge carryover

• Can’t be solved by subdivision into parts

• No meaningful way to practice

Page 13: The Interdisciplinary World General Education as a Basis for Career and Service Herb Childress Boston Architectural College.

Wicked ProblemsOUTCOME CHARACTERISTICS:

• No right answers, though some are better

• No immediate or ultimate test of solutions

• No stopping rule

Page 14: The Interdisciplinary World General Education as a Basis for Career and Service Herb Childress Boston Architectural College.

Wicked ProblemsETHICAL CHARACTERISTICS:

• Has to be solved by those who made it

• Harm is done while we wait

• Inaction is a choice among actions

• We have no right to be wrong

Page 17: The Interdisciplinary World General Education as a Basis for Career and Service Herb Childress Boston Architectural College.

Here’s a problem…City Peak

population2010

populationChange

Detroit 1,849,600 713,800 -61.2%

Saginaw 98,300 55,200 -43.8%

Flint 196,000 111,500 -43.1%

Youngstown 168,300 72,400 -57.2%

Toledo 383,800 316,200 -17.6%

Gary 178,300 80,300 -55.0%

These cities have smaller and poorer populations, which means their tax bases are shot… but the same amount of roads to pave and plow, sewers and water mains to maintain, land area to protect with police and fire service.

2.2a. Baccalaureate programs engage students in an integrated course of study of sufficient breadth and depth to prepare them for work, citizenship, and life-long learning. These programs ensure the development of core competencies including, but not limited to, written and oral communication, quantitative reasoning, information literacy, and critical thinking. In addition, baccalaureate programs actively foster creativity, innovation, an appreciation for diversity, ethical and civic responsibility, civic engagement, and the ability to work with others. Baccalaureate programs also ensure breadth for all students in cultural and aesthetic, social and political, and scientific and technical knowledge expected of educated persons. Undergraduate degrees include significant in-depth study in a given area of knowledge (typically described in terms of a program or major).
